Use the table to answer the question.

x | y | (x, y)
0 | | (0, )
1 | | (1, )
2 | | (2, )
Complete the ordered pairs in the table by finding the y-value of the ordered pairs for the equation y = 5x.
A. (0, 0), (5, 1), (10, 2)
B. (0, 0), (1, 5), (3, 15)
C. (0, 0), (1, 5), (2, 10)
D. (0, 0), (1, 1/5), (2, 2/5)

1 answer

To complete the ordered pairs in the table using the equation \( y = 5x \), we can calculate the y-values for each corresponding x-value in the table:

  1. For \( x = 0 \): \[ y = 5(0) = 0 \] So the ordered pair is \( (0, 0) \).

  2. For \( x = 1 \): \[ y = 5(1) = 5 \] So the ordered pair is \( (1, 5) \).

  3. For \( x = 2 \): \[ y = 5(2) = 10 \] So the ordered pair is \( (2, 10) \).

Now we can write the complete ordered pairs:

  • \( (0, 0) \)
  • \( (1, 5) \)
  • \( (2, 10) \)

Thus, the correct answer is: C. \( (0, 0), (1, 5), (2, 10) \)
